Overview
The procurement - Below threshold procurement was undertaken for the appointment of a Design Consultant to develop the scheme from feasibility stage through to Concept Design (approximately 30% design maturity). The Service Provider is expected to deliver a complete, fit-for-purpose solution consistent with the standards of a competent and experienced infrastructure design organisation. Rail for London Infrastructure will rely on the appointed Consultant's expertise in delivering services of this scale and complexity - The contract Value was for £151,000 and Tony Gee Partners LLP have been awarded the contract
